I am very excited at the prospect of ex Western Bulldogs player Jason Akermanis having free reins to use that motor mouth of his and truly voice his own opinions in the media world. No longer tied to any contract or club obligations, he will give the afl public a non watered down outlook of the afl world.

I truly believe the Western Bulldogs, as a club, has left him out to dry. Big deal if he was releasing a book at the end of the year. The main issue that caused the Bulldogs to terminate his contract was the fact that there were RUMOURS circulating that aker dished out some dirt on 3 of his ex bulldogs team mates in ONE of the chapters. Now how many chapters are in a book?? Most often in excess of 10. So it seems that a minor non-confirmed piece of writing has brought an end to an illustrious career of a top football player. Disgraceful. And the instigator of the termination of the walking headline act was none other than Bulldogs captain, brad Johnson. He heard about what aker was up to and instead of doing the logical task of sitting down and chatting to aker about it, johnno went straight to the top dogs at the club and ranted to them about the situation. Surely if johnno asked aker first what was going on with the whole situation in spilling the beans about his team mates, aker would have given the reasoning behind it and maybe omit the incriminating evidence. But johnno decided enough was enough on his own accord and decided to get aker terminated.
